Muchas gracias a todos por las respuestas.

 

 

  _____  

De: [email protected] [mailto:[email protected]] En nombre de Leonardo Micheloni
Enviado el: viernes, 12 de junio de 2009 13:01
Para: [email protected]
Asunto: [dbms] Ayuda con update

 

nop

2009/6/12 Jesús dos Santos <[email protected]>

Claro, un trigger los he usado para insertar, ahora si yo hago lo siguiente

CREATE TRIGGER  registrar ON tabla 

FOR update

AS

update tabla  set registro=getdate() where modeloid = (select modeloid from
inserted)

 

esto no es recursivo? Pues estoy generando otro update ??

 

Muchas gracias

 

 

 

  _____  

De: [email protected] [mailto:[email protected]] En nombre de Leonardo Micheloni
Enviado el: viernes, 12 de junio de 2009 11:39
Para: [email protected]
Asunto: [dbms] Ayuda con update

 

Poniendo el getdate en el sp que actualiza, sino con un trigger for update

http://msdn.microsoft.com/en-us/library/aa258254(SQL.80).aspx

saludos, Leonardo.

 

2009/6/12 Jesús dos Santos <[email protected]>

Lista, disculpen la consulta, quiero que se me registre en un campo de una
tabla sql 2000, la fecha y hora cuando se produce un update en esa tabla. 

Cuando es un registro nuevo, uso como valor predeterminado el getdate(),
pero al hacer un update, como seria???

Desde ya muchas gracias.

 

 

 

Responder a